Output efaa7e706881fd783c85087b91ecb298f98682e48ac1ece857e31d837652d277:0

value
31464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ef5004414e2ec6d3e393a19e8f4321bb36335d0 OP_EQUAL
address
34WhhGa71QRspshP6jeKjpYCQFLrXnRcPy
transaction
efaa7e706881fd783c85087b91ecb298f98682e48ac1ece857e31d837652d277
spent
true